Abstract
Aliphatic alcohols (AA) modified yield and yield components of okra, s timulated net photosynthetic rate (P-N) and enhanced mobilization and efficient partitioning of photosynthates to the seeds. With AA the ave rage number of seeds/fruit increased significantly over the control; s ugar, amino acids and starch contents decreased and concomitantly the contents of proteins and oil increased. The okra stem serves as a stor age organ for photosynthates and subsequent retranslocation to other p arts. The influence of AA in stimulating the transport of assimilates was independent of leaf position.
